The Roman Catholic Diocese of Moosonee (Latin: Dioecesis Musonitana) is a Roman Catholic diocese that includes part of the Province of Ontario. It is currently led by an Apostolic Adminiatrator, Bishop Robert Bourgon of the Diocese of Hearst.
As of 2013, the diocese contains 12 parishes with no active diocesan priests, 3 religious priests, and 7,200 Catholics. It also has 5 religious brothers and 1 permanent deacon.
Diocesan bishops
The following is a list of the bishops of Moosonee and their terms of service:
- Jules Leguerrier (1967-1992)
- Vincent Cadieux, OMI (1991-2016)
- Robert Bourgon (Apostolic Administrator 2016-present)
